Williamsport Area High School is a large, urban, public high school located in Williamsport, Lycoming County, Pennsylvania. The school is located at 2990 West 4th Street, Williamsport. In the 2017–18 school year, enrollment was reported as 1,489 pupils in 9th through 12th grades.
Serving 1,492 students in grades 9-12, Williamsport Area Sr. High School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Pennsylvania for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 40% (which is higher than the Pennsylvania state average of 38%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 62% (which is higher than the Pennsylvania state average of 55%).
The student-teacher ratio of 14:1 is higher than the Pennsylvania state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ment is 40%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the Pennsylvania state average of 39% (majority Hispanic and Black).
